Old Mutual splits top asset manager roles

Peter Baxter, chief executive of Old Mutual Asset Managers, the UK funds arm of the South Africa-based insurer, has handed his chief investment officer role to quant head Eoin Murray.

Baxter took over from former chief executive John Ainsworth in April last year, having previously been chief investment officer and deputy chief executive. Murray's appointment re-separates the roles.
